The BMW 328ci Convertible has been tested by the EPA across 12 different configurations spanning model years 2007 through 2012. Over this period, the 328ci Convertible has achieved combined fuel economy ratings ranging from 20 MPG to 21 MPG, with an overall average of 21 MPG across all engine, transmission, and drivetrain combinations.
